Simple caesar cipher python
WebbThe Caesar cipher is the simplest and oldest method of cryptography. The Caesar cipher method is based on a mono-alphabetic cipher and is also called a shift cipher or additive cipher. Julius Caesar used the shift cipher (additive cipher) technique to … WebbThis project uses Python 3. We recommend using trinket to write Python online. This project contains the following Trinkets: New (blank) Python Trinket ... Use a Caesar cipher - encrypt and decrypt letters and words manually; Variable keys - allowing the user to …
Simple caesar cipher python
Did you know?
WebbThe Caesar Cipher was one of the earliest ciphers ever invented. In this cipher, you encrypt a message by taking each letter in the message (in cryptography, these letters are called symbols because they can be letters, numbers, or any other sign) and replacing it … WebbSimple substitution cipher is the most commonly used cipher and includes an algorithm of substituting every plain text character for every cipher text character. In this process, alphabets are jumbled in comparison with Caesar cipher algorithm. Example Keys for a simple substitution cipher usually consists of 26 letters. An example key is −
Webb1 juni 2014 · A Python package and command line script for encoding, decoding and cracking Caesar ciphers. Project description A Python package and command line script for encoding, decoding and cracking messages with the Caesar Shift Cipher. Table of Contents Features Installation Usage Development Meta Features Encoding Decoding Webb1 apr. 2024 · Uses execve syscall to spawn bash. The string is ceasar cipher crypted with the increment key of 7 within the shellcode. The shellcode finds the string in memory, copies the string to the stack, deciphers the string, and then changes the string terminator to 0x00. # Shoutout to IBM X-Force Red Adversary Simulation team!
WebbTo implement the Caesar cipher in python, we are going to use the function ord. This function returns the Unicode code for a single character. For instance, ord (‘a’)=97, ord (‘b’) = 98, ord (‘c’)=99, …, ord (‘z’)=122 The opposite function in python is chr. For instance, chr (97)=’a’, chr (98)=’b’ and so on. So, let’s see the python code. Webb7 nov. 2014 · simple Implementation using: string.maketrans import string upper_case = string.uppercase trans = lambda x,n:string.maketrans (x,x [n:]+x [:n]) def ceaser (text,n): …
Webb22 juli 2024 · my suggestion is instead of creating dictionary this will be lot simpler def apply_shift (shift, letter): asci = ord (letter) new_ascii = 97 + (asci + shift -97) % 26 return …
bismarck toyota cedricWebb29 maj 2024 · Caesar Cipher Using Python. Now, we will be writing the code for implementing the caesar cipher algorithm. We shall be defining two functions – one for … bismarck townhomes for saleWebb27 aug. 2024 · It’s very basic python implementation of shift cipher, also known as Caesar Cipher, Polybius cipher or ROT 13 (depends on shifting value), which is primitive form of substitution cipher. I was intending to start writing about things related to cryptography, so we will begin with “ back to the roots ”! History & simple math bismarck trap shootingWebb14 mars 2024 · In Python, we have the translate method which applies a substitution cipher to a string. More, when building the translation table, in Python 2, we have … darlington borough council libraryWebbCaesar Cipher Technique is the simple and easy method of encryption technique. It is simple type of substitution cipher. Each letter of plain text is replaced by a letter with … bismarck toyotaWebb8 okt. 2009 · def caesar (inputstring): shifted=string.lowercase [3:]+string.lowercase [:3] return "".join (shifted [string.lowercase.index (letter)] for letter in inputstring) and reverse: … bismarck trap clubWebb7 apr. 2024 · 算法(Python版)今天准备开始学习一个热门项目:The Algorithms - Python。 参与贡献者众多,非常热门,是获得156K星的神级项目。 项目地址 git地址项目概况说明Python中实现的所有算法-用于教育 实施仅用于学习目… bismarck trail ranch sd owners